Guest #8 was a friendly reunion with a Marine that I served with. I saw a Bryan Hubbard post where he read off a letter from the wife of a Marine who was struggling from the loss of his teammates in Iraq. December 1st 2005 was a tragic day for our battalion that left 10 dead and 11 wounded. This event put a sadness in him that he carried for 20 years. After hearing a podcast about Ibogaine, he and his wife went down to Mexico to investigate all the hype... and received more than they had ever imagined. This is his story
